just arrived is this book : make your own electric guitar" by melvyn hiscock.
if u buy that, it'll be all u neeed. im readin through it like it was my grandma's will and im learning loads!! just as sooon as my jackson neck arrives ill start production on the guitar. it coverss everything from tools and preps to woods and materials and finishing and setups. 200pages of guitar building goodness.
10/10-recomend it eyes closed!
